The Dynamic Nature of God's Power and Human Autonomy
This chapter examines the theological concepts of God's active presence and interventions in a world filled with suffering and evil, emphasizing the notion of divine self-limitation alongside human autonomy. It critiques traditional views of God's sovereignty, promoting a model of God's nurturing love that invites active engagement with social injustices rather than passive acceptance. By exploring the balance between God's providence and human responsibility, the discussion encourages a deeper understanding of hope and divine partnership in creating goodness in the world.
